Date and time of
recording are not
correct.

If the camera clock has not been set (“Date not set”

indicator blinks during shooting), still pictures have a time
stamp of “00/00/0000 00:00”; and movies are dated “01/
01/2011 00:00.” Set the correct date and time using Time
zone and date
in the setup menu.

The camera clock is not as accurate as a normal clock, such

as watches. Check camera clock regularly against more
accurate timepieces and reset as required.

Camera settings
reset.

Clock battery is exhausted; all settings were restored to their
default values.

189

Reset file
numbering

cannot be done.

• Reset file numbering cannot be applied when the

folder number reaches 999 and there are images in the
folder. Change the memory card, or format the internal
memory/memory card.

• Reset file numbering cannot be set when the scene

mode is set to Panorama, or when the shooting mode is
j, k, l, m or M and Intvl timer shooting is chosen for
the continuous shooting.
